There are a lot of comments about the complex being too expensive. I agree that it's pricey, but in fairness, you do get a lot for your money - the units are beautiful and spacious, and well laid out. At 1400 sq ft for a 3 br/2ba, it's like having your own home or condo, not an apartment. They are fairly quiet (no upstairs/downstairs neighbors to worry about, only connecting walls are via the garage), washer/dryer are included, have a two car attached garage, decent landscaping, the grounds are fairly clean and maintained, nice club house and pool area (when the pool and hot tub aren't full of frogs), adequate workout room, and have decent appliances. However, where the complex falls short is in the management and policies. We were served notice that our patio area (which is not private, btw, another issue I have with the complex) was cluttered and needed to be cleaned. All we had out there was a small table and chairs set (2 chairs), a grill (with the charcoal and starter chimney tucked into a corner), and a small tray table we kept to set whatever we were cooking on. Other people in the complex have HUGE patio sets, kiddie pools, toys, planters, etc strewn all over their patios and onto the lawn, and they were never told it was too cluttered. Management also seems to be under the impression that after an apartment is lived in for multiple years, everything will still be in pristine condition. We spent hours cleaning the apartment before vacating, and still were hit with a bill for a professional cleaning crew. Things were replaced in the apartment that were not in need of replacement (and we were charged for them - ridiculous things, like the tub stopper and light bulbs). We were told when we moved out that because we'd been there so long, we wouldn't be charged for repainting the apartment, yet we were (at a discounted rate, but charged nonetheless). All of our deposit was taken by these ridiculous charges because they seemed to be trying to bring the apartment back to "new" condition. So if you rent here, do not expect to get any of your deposit back. You won't see a dime of it. Also, maintenance issues are not dealt with in any kind of timely manner. It was nothing to wait more than a week to have major issues dealt with, and one took nearly two months. Calling the office did no good - each time we did, we were assured it was going to be taken care of, then the days would drag by. Another issue I have, as mentioned above, is that the patio areas afford no privacy what-so-ever - your patio faces another across the way, no barriers at all. So anyone can just walk up onto your patio at any time. The neighbor's dog always pooped on my patio, and they never cleaned it up. And more than once, I caught some creepy neighbor kid on my patio, taunting my dog through the window. And if you have your patio blinds open, your across the court neighbors can easily see into your home. We kept them closed almost all the time, just to allow ourselves some privacy. The complex is pet friendly, however, management doesn't seem willing to enforce the "dogs must be on leash" rule. There were MANY dogs allowed to run loose in the complex, doing their business wherever they felt like, with the owners not bothering to clean up after them. Also, while they claim that only "small pets" are allowed, I saw several very big dogs who lived in the complex. We wish that had been made an option for us, because we would have gotten a bigger dog had it been. Jasmine Parke is a nice complex with decent amenities, but the management leaves a lot to be desired, as does maintenance. And if you actually LIVE in your apartment, don't expect to ever see your security deposit again.
